Located just 21 minutes from the town of Gunnison, Colorado, Quartz Creek Ranch spans approximately 114 acres in a secluded mountain valley. This private holding offers an uncommon mix of water resources, high-quality improvements, and recreational value in one of Colorado’s most scenic regions. The property is centered around a rebuilt four-bedroom, three-bathroom main residence that blends updated finishes with warm rustic character. In addition to the primary home, five thoughtfully maintained guest cabinseach with its own personalityprovide accommodations for visitors, extended family, or potential rental income. The buildings are positioned to balance privacy and community, making the property well-suited for retreats or multi-generational use.
Quartz Creek transverses the property for .75 miles and is complemented by a private trout lake, offering the opportunity to catch Brown and Rainbow trout. The setting is quiet, the views are uninterrupted, and the live water features add measurable value. More than 100 acres of irrigated ground suitable for hay production or grazing.
Improvements extend beyond the residences. The ranch includes a workout and game room, and multiple buildings providing utility for storage or creative projects. Located within Colorado Game Management Unit 55, the property is eligible for over-the-counter 2nd and 3rd rifle season tags, positioning it as a base for consistent hunting access.
